I’ve reviewed your post and understood that you need assistance with regards to selling of novel food in Amazon.co.uk marketplace.

Novel food means any food that was not used for human consumption to a significant degree within the European Union before 15 May 1997.

Prior to selling any Novel foods or products containing Novel foods, you need to notify the competent authority and obtain all necessary authorizations (Regulation (EU) 2015/2283).

A list of the EU novel food authorizations can be found here.

Products containing ingredients that are not authorised or are restricted under the Novel Food Regulations, such as:

  • Miracle berry
  • Globe amaranth
  • Pueraria Mirificia
  • Epimedium
  • Beta-hydroxybutyrate (BHB)
  • Ketones, Ketone salts/esters and synthetic raspberry ketones

If you have received a violation of selling unregistered novel food under your account then please refer to the latest performance notification sent by our team and follow the guidelines provided under what action you need to take.

If you feel that your products has incorrectly identified as restricted then you can always report the issue toseller support team.
